I would like to know how much of our earning do we give to the needy. One of my christian friend said that every month she gives 10% to god, i.e church and charity. Do sikhs have a similar idea? I try to give money every month but i donate random amounts. Thank you for your time and help.


**********
reply
***********
Sat nam. Tithing is about giving 10% to God's work, so typically one tithes to one's place or organization of worship, whether a gurdwara, a church, a temple, or the umbrella association that oversees the particular place of worship. Giving to the needy, while important, is not considered the same as tithing. How much one gives to the needy is totally personal and up to the giver.
